Trinity Support & Care Services is a progressive healthcare organisation delivering high-quality, person-centred services across Northern Ireland and the Republic of Ireland.
As we continue to grow, we're looking for an exceptional Executive Assistant & Business Operations Coordinator to become an integral part of our leadership team.
This is much more than a traditional administration role. We're looking for someone who can provide outstanding executive support while helping us modernise the way we work through innovation, technology and Artificial Intelligence (AI).
You'll become a trusted partner to our senior leadership team, helping to improve systems, streamline processes and drive operational excellence across the organisation.
If you're highly organised, proactive, tech-savvy and enjoy making a real impact, we'd love to hear from you.
The RoleReporting directly to the Senior Leadership Team, you ll provide executive and operational support across the organisation, ensuring our business functions run efficiently and effectively.
You ll also play a key role in helping Trinity embrace digital transformation by identifying opportunities to improve processes, introducing AI-powered solutions and supporting continuous improvement initiatives.
This is an exciting opportunity for someone who enjoys solving problems, taking ownership and helping an organisation grow.
Key ResponsibilitiesExecutive Support
- Provide high-level administrative and executive support to the Senior Leadership Team.
- Manage complex diaries, appointments and meeting schedules.
- Coordinate events.
- Prepare professional reports, presentations, correspondence, agendas and meeting minutes.
- Act as the first point of contact for internal and external stakeholders.
- Handle confidential and sensitive information with absolute discretion.
Business Operations
- Coordinate the smooth day-to-day running of the office.
- Manage incoming calls, emails, correspondence and visitors.
- Maintain accurate electronic filing systems and organisational records.
- Monitor operational returns and ensure actions are completed on time.
- Maintain governance documentation, compliance records and organisational policies.
- Support recruitment administration, onboarding and employee records.
- Coordinate mandatory training records and staff development administration.
- Assist with payroll administration, invoices, purchasing and expense processing.
- Support business improvement projects across the organisation.
Digital Innovation & AI
Technology is becoming increasingly important in healthcare, and we're looking for someone who is excited about using it to improve how we work.
You'll help us:
- Identify opportunities to improve efficiency through AI and automation.
- Introduce AI tools to reduce repetitive administrative tasks.
- Develop AI-assisted workflows for HR, recruitment, compliance and operational reporting.
- Create templates, knowledge resources and digital systems that improve productivity.
- Support colleagues in adopting new technologies and digital ways of working.
- Research emerging AI tools and recommend practical solutions.
- Work alongside senior management to continuously improve business processes.
Previous experience using AI tools such as ChatGPT or Microsoft Copilot would be an advantage, but a willingness to learn and embrace new technology is just as important.
Governance & Compliance- Maintain confidential records in accordance with UK and Irish GDPR legislation.
- Support compliance with healthcare regulations, employment legislation and organisational governance requirements.
- Maintain audit trails, compliance trackers and quality documentation.
- Assist in preparing documentation for inspections, audits and internal reviews.
- Promote best practice in information governance and record management.
